I have a neighbour who's quality of life is being drastically diminished by masc. degeneration.

I've made accessibility changes to her windows machine to there's a huge zoom, giant cursor, etc. She's happy when using the PC - but away from that, things are getting her down quite a bit.

What I've suggested might help is a head mounted display with a zoomable/macro-ish camera with a composite out going into the HMD - something like the i-cine Hi Res.

Basically, what I'm asking is, what camera type will have a zoom, is decent quality but low cost, can be hand held, and features image stabilisation.

If she has the option to mount something onto the goggles/headset, she might be able to sit with the other half and enjoy a film etc. If the camera is hand held she can zoom in on a book or the newspaper, which is something important to her.

What sort of camera should I be looking for? 'Barrel/bullet' or something? It needs to have RCA composite out, as the guys at i-Cine have pointed out.
